Tourism Radio on Highway 400 will air Ontario Tourism Reports from renowned travel reporter Jack Lynch, Travel Promotion Officer with the Ontario Travel Information Centre in Barrie.
While driving north or southbound 400 highway motorists will be able to listen to Jack's informative tourism reports each week on highway 400 between highway 89 exit and Innisfil Beach Road exit, just south of the City of Barrie. For weekend events our station will broadcast continuous looping 24/7 Jack Lynch reports every few minutes starting Friday to Sunday for all the important weekend tourism events.
